Sour Cream Sweet Potato Pie

By gothmoth03
A Holiday favorite!
- 1 9 inch unbaked pie crust
- 3 eggs, separated
- 16 oz sweet potatoes, mashed (about 2 cups) Use canned potatoes, or for better flavor, boil sweet potatoes until tender and mash.
- 1 cup sugar
- 1 cup sour cream
- 1/2 teaspoon cinnamon
- 1/4 teaspoon ginger
- 1/8 teaspoon ground cloves
- 1/4 teaspoon salt

Granny's Texas Baked Beans

By gothmoth03
Yummy spicy-sweet beans perfect for barbecues!
- 1 16oz. can green lima beans
- 1 16 oz. can red kidney beans
- 1 16 oz. can navy beans,
- 1 large onion , finely chopped
- 1 teaspoon garlic salt
- 1 teaspoon seasoned salt
- 1 teaspoon dry mustard
- 1/4 teaspoon black pepper
- 3 tablespoons brown sugar
- 1/2 cup ketchup
- 3 tablespoons vinegar
- 3/4 cups water
- 3 strips of bacon,fried crisp
